I'm back in action! Couple of new things. Got a promotion which came with a new city so we've headed to Richmond, VA. Any square friends out here please reach out. I need some good contacts for shops, powder coaters, etc.. So in the last 2 months I have striped down the front all the way to the frame. No coming back now! Pull the cab, tore the motor down and sent to an engine shop for machine work, sold the tranny and 203, and started ordering parts galore. Along with the parts, I put on some new leaf packs in the front. Went with the 3 vs the stock 2. Also added the Offroad Design shackles up front. Picked up a NP205 with a slip yoke and 27 spline input for an auto. My goal is to have a 700r4 w/ the np205 Twin sticked and the factory rebuilt 350. Stock suspension for now. Got the front 10 bolt hung and sway bar up. Used Energy Suspension Poly bushings on the bar. Should firm things up a bit. I also installed new spiders in the fr carrier to tighten up the factory slop. That was suggested by the guy who set up my front ring & pinion. Yukon Gears on that!
Pressing in the ball joints today and should have those and the hubs mounted by tomorrow. Attachment 1517481 Attachment 1517482 Attachment 1517486 Attachment 1517487 |
